Data report overview

The dataset examined has the following dimensions:

Feature Result
Number of observations 332
Number of variables 20

Codebook summary table

Label Variable Class # unique values Missing Description
Participant number, auto-assigned based on rows in data preparation Participant integer 332 0.00 %
Factorial variable manipulating whether the text described AI as having an augmentation that made it rapidly increase in either intelligence or morality Condition factor 2 0.00 %
Perceived intelligence, prior to the augmentation - ‘How generally intelligent do you think OmegaAGI is? That is, how much do you think it can reason generally, solve new problems, and generate new knowledge?’ (1 = not at all; 7= very much) Pre_Intelligent numeric 7 0.00 %
Perceived intelligence in comparison to a human, prior to the augmentation - ’Compared to a human, how generally intelligent do you think OmegaAI is?’ (-3 = much less than a human; 0 = equal to a human; 3 = much more than a human) Pre_Intelligent_Comparison numeric 7 0.00 %
Perceived morality, prior to the augmentation - ‘In general, how moral do you think OmegaAI would be? That is, how much do you think that it would support the same kinds of ethical values and behaviors that, ideally, humans would agree are important?’ (1 = not at all; 7= very much) Pre_Moral numeric 7 0.00 %
Perceived morality, prior to the augmentation - ’Compared to a human, how moral do you think OmegaAI would be?’ (-3 = much less than a human; 0 = equal to a human; 3 = much more than a human) Pre_Moral_Comparison numeric 7 0.00 %
Perceived trustworthiness, prior to the augmentation - ‘To what extent do you think that OmegaAI would be trustworthy?’ (1 = not at all; 7= very much) Pre_Trust numeric 7 0.00 %
Perceived danger, prior to the augmentation - ‘To what extent do you think that OmegaAI is likely to present a danger to us?’ (1 = not at all; 7= very much) Pre_Danger numeric 7 0.00 %
Perceived intelligence, after the augmentation - ‘As a result of this new breakthrough, how generally intelligent do you think OmegaAI is now? That is, how much do you think it can reason, problem solve, and acquire new knowledge?’ (1 = not at all; 7= very much) Post_Intelligent numeric 7 0.00 %
Perceived intelligence in comparison to average person, after the augmentation - ‘As a result of this new breakthrough, compared to a human, how generally intelligent do you think OmegaAI is now?’ (-3 = much less than a human; 0 = equal to a human; 3 = much more than a human) Post_Intelligent_Comparison numeric 7 0.00 %
Perceived morality, after the augmentation - ‘As a result of this new breakthrough, how moral do you think OmegaAI will now be? That is, how much do you think that it would support the same kinds of ethical values and behaviors that humans, ideally, would agree are important?’ (1 = not at all; 7= very much) Post_Moral numeric 7 0.00 %
Perceived morality in comparison to average person, after the augmentation - ‘As a result of this new breakthrough, compared to a human, how moral do you think OmegaAI will now be?’ (-3 = much less than a human; 0 = equal to a human; 3 = much more than a human) Post_Moral_Comparison numeric 7 0.00 %
Perceived danger, after the augmentation - ‘As a result of this new breakthrough, to what extent do you think that OmegaAI is likely to now present a danger to us?’ (1 = not at all; 7= very much) Post_Danger numeric 7 0.00 %
Perceived trustworthiness, after the augmentation - ‘As a result of this new breakthrough, to what extent do you think that OmegaAI would now be trustworthy?’ (1 = not at all; 7= very much) Post_Trust numeric 7 0.00 %
Attention Check 1 (Tiktok) AttentionCheck character 1 0.00 %
Attention Check 2 (Post-Manipulation) - ‘Earlier in this study you were presented with some information about an AI that changed in some way due to some technique. How was this AI change described?’ (1 = The AI became rapidly more generally intelligent; 2 = The AI became rapidly more moral; 3 = The AI became less general; 4 = The AI became better at mathematics; 5 = The AI became better at image identification) AttentionTwo character 1 0.00 %
Participant age, in numeric form Age numeric 58 0.00 %
Participant gender recoded to as a factor to be male, female, non-binary/other, and not say Gender factor 3 0.00 %
Self-reported familiarity with AI - ‘How much do you think you know about AI, how it works, and how it is used?’ (1 = not at all; 7= very much) Familiarity numeric 7 0.00 %
Self-reported familiarity with AI, means-centered Familiarity_c numeric 7 0.00 %
